From Nail Harmony (the brand who brought you Gelish, the first brush-in-bottle nail polish) comes ‘All That Jazz’.
Thankfully, All That Jazz gives you the same, high quality finish as a gel manicure. This is great for me, as I began to develop contact dermatitis every time I used gel polish with a UV lamp.
All That Jazz bring out a new collection quarterly. So essentially, a new selection of shades for each season. You can also purchase the shades separately for £9.98 each (free postage) or as a collection for £29.95.
I was kindly gifted the Designer Collection to try, which are totally kind of shades. Inspired by iconic fashion designers, and runway glamour. The shades are:
Vivienne – A purple with shimmering blue hue
Coco – a deep, metallic red
Vera – A gorgeous nude
Betsey – Stunning, sparkly silver sequins
They are all quick drying, even with two coats. However, I’d recommend a top coat to extend their life without chipping. The silver Betsey is perfect for a feature finger or for adding detail to the other nails.
On removal, there was absolutely no damage, or stainage and they were easy to remove with a general polish remover. Generally, they last two to three days. But, by this point, I want to change the colour anyway!
